Run ID 作者 问题 语言 测评结果 时间 内存 代码长度 提交时间
42086 WZH 九进制回文数 C++ 解答错误 0 MS 252 KB 491 2024-02-24 10:08:18

Tests(0/1):


#include<iostream> using namespace std; int main() { int jz=9,cnt=0,n,m; cin>>n>>m; for(int i=n;i<=m;i++){ int x=i,a9=0,b9,p=1; bool f=true; while(x){ if(x%jz%2==0){ f=false; break; } a9=a9*10+x%jz; b9=b9+x%jz*p; p=p*10; x/=jz; } if(a9==b9&&f){ cnt++; } } cout<<cnt; return 0; }


测评信息: